When you are faced with the difficult task of learning a large amount of information, study it at several locations. This is so you can dissociate information with one place and instead encourages more general recall.

Exercise is one of boosting your memory.Exercise improves memory by improving blood flow and directly impacts cognitive function.
Changing your surroundings often keeps the mind alert, and causes long-term memory to be more efficacious. Your brain will start taking in all the new details of your environment, allowing you to intake new information with ease.
Stay socially active if you want to keep your memory healthy. This will keep you stay alert and happy.If you stay at home alone all the time, your brain does not get stimulated and exercised. Regular exercise can have a great strategy to help improve your memory. Even a small amount of exercise performed regularly can lead to improvements.
Don’t overload yourself with too much information in one sitting.If there is something you must remember, make study sessions. It will never be advantageous to learn information in one go. Your mind will become overwhelmed, just when you need it. Make sure you study segments to ensure that your brain can remember things.
Even if you’re not currently in college or school, it is vital that you keep learning new things. If you aren’t learning new things, the memory-storing part of your brain isn’t stimulated. When you don’t stretch your memory on a regular basis, it is going to be harder.
